Getting coins from Great Britain has become more common even with their odd shapes. I actually got two 1993 twenty pence coins as nickels on two separate occasions.
As a collector I love the fact NYC is a tourist hotspot but as a resident it can be annoying. I would not receive even a fraction of these odd coins if I lived anywhere else. People from around the U.S. and the world often say they refuse to take non-local change. While in NYC it is so busy that as long as you pay most cashiers forgive the occasionally odd coin.
Europeans in NYC are often confused by our coinage and honestly make an effort to give the right change but if slip ups occur the cashier does not argue much. Same with New Yorkers attitude on receiving funny money, they often say whatever and pass it off next time they shop. I am one of the few people who actually seek out the wrong change.
Here's the stats...
Type/Country: 20 Pence / Great Britain
Year: 1993
Mintage: 123,124,000
Metal: 84% Copper, 16% Nickel
Value: $0.35 in VF
